The radioactivity of Co, Ni, Cu and Zn induced by neutrons of different energies is investigated. When bombarding Cu and Zn with fast neutrons, periods are observed which make us suppose that two neutrons are emitted by these nuclei. Experiments to confirm this presumption are described.
